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Hackney Wick to Penrhyndeudraeth start from as little as £19.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Hackney Wick to Penrhyndeudraeth start from £77.70 one way, or £96.80 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Hackney Wick to Penrhyndeudraeth are available for £121.90 one way, or £207.60 return

Station Amenities and Accessibility

Hackney Wick train station is equipped with essential facilities to ensure a comfortable experience, although it might lack some of the niceties you'd find in larger stations. For buying tickets, you can make use of the ticket machines and collect pre-purchased tickets from there as well. However, traditional ticket office services are limited to weekday mornings (from 07:30 to 10:00). The station's notable focus on accessibility includes step-free access throughout, accessible ticket machines, and a range of facilities tailored to assist those needing additional support.

The station is aimed at being inclusive for all travelers. While there are no ordinary toilets, you will find accessible toilets available, making it easier for everyone to navigate through journeys without unnecessary hassle. Additionally, waiting rooms are open Monday to Friday from 07:00 to 13:00, but note there isn't continuous staff assistance throughout the week.

Onward Connections and Travel Options

Getting around from Hackney Wick is straightforward thanks to its decent local transport connections. For those times when rail services are interrupted, bus stops in Hepscott Road offer rail replacement services, ensuring you can still make your way east towards Stratford or west towards Camden Road, Hampstead Heath, and Richmond. It should be noted that while cycling is encouraged, with storage for up to six bicycles monitored by CCTV, there are no cycle hire facilities at the station.

Facilities and Amenities

Visitors to Penrhyndeudraeth station will find limited facilities due to its small size. There is no ticket office or ticket machines available on-site, so purchasing tickets in advance online or from nearby stations with more comprehensive facilities is advised. Help and support are accessible via a helpline, though customer help points are absent. Accessibility is somewhat limited; there is step-free access to the platform from the car park, but no waiting rooms, seating areas, or accessible toilet facilities are available. The station does feature an induction loop to assist those with hearing impairments and a ramp is available for train access.

Transport Connections

Penrhyndeudraeth is well-placed for connectivity despite its rural setting. The nearest bus stop is just a short walk away, about 200 meters on the A487, providing convenience to those looking to explore the region further. For those times when train services are disrupted, a rail replacement bus service operates from the station front. Unfortunately, there are no cycle hire facilities at the station, so bringing your own bicycle or arranging a car rental may be necessary for further travel from the station.
